Unique Items are the highest quality items in Dungeon Siege III, they are orange or blue and are much rarer than other items. Orange items correspond to legendary items. Legendary items are unique items that are not randomly generated. Usually they have a specific requirements for being obtained and always have the same statistics and are always located in the same place.

There's a number of one-off items, both rare and unique, that are either exclusive for one of four playable characters, or accessories that can be used by any character. These items can be either bought off from mechants, recieved as a quest reward or found as rare drops from specific enemies or bosses. It is worth noting that some items obtained from killing certain enemies or as rewards from NPCs depend on the character chosen by the player.

All of them have certain effects which are described in the help topics. Basically they just affect combat damage in various ways.

  • Retribution: Sometimes damages the attacker when you get hit
  • Bloodletting: Sometimes causes bleeding when you hit enemies
  • Doom: Increases critical strike damage
  • Warding: Provides a chance to stun enemies that hit you.

General Items[]

Or, to put it simply, accessories—trinkets imbued with magic to grant some benefits to the player. There are two slots for general items, and they both can be used by any played character—Amulet and Ring—available one item per item slot each.

Notes[]

  • The numerical values ​​of the characteristics of some items depend on the level of the character who found them and may differ if you get them at different stages of the game.
  • In different versions (?) of the game, there may be some differences when obtaining items: in particular, unique spears for Anjali - Heaven's Judgment (empowered) and Vorpal Glaive - can be obtained differently. Both spears can be obtained at the Chancel of Azunai under different conditions: improved Heaven's Judgment drops from Saraya if you previosly kill Rajani, the Glaive - from Rajani, if you first leave her alive, and then refuse to spare the archons in the castle garden. In some versions, they frop vice versa: Glaive - Saraya, Judgment - from Rajani.
  • Also, there may be a difference in rewards from Bartholomew for the "Prototype" quest for Katarina. In some versions, instead of gloves, a shotgun "Frostforged Scattergun" (?) is issued.
  • Converting a legendary orange item at the Items menu screen will guarantee you an essence - or a few, if the stats in question are multiple.
